![use arp command to find mac address use arp command to find mac address](https://www.lifewire.com/thmb/zXACW-NXk-kKC2uI0B3tzVd0GyQ=/768x0/filters:no_upscale():max_bytes(150000):strip_icc()/terminalonmacOSdesktop-5c6f1c9bc9e77c000149e46d.jpg)
The Source MAC address is, unsurprisingly, the MAC address of our sender – Host A. Had Host A chosen to send this frame using a specific host’s MAC address in the destination, then the ARP request would have been unicast. This is what makes an ARP Request a broadcast. Notice the Layer 2 Destination is, this is the special reserved MAC address indicating a broadcast frame. The Ethernet header will include three fields: a Destination MAC address, a Source MAC address, and an EtherType. The majority of the time this will be Ethernet, which will also be the L2 medium we will be looking at in our examples. The ARP Request is an ARP payload carried within the appropriate L2 frame for the medium in use. Now that you understand the general process, let’s take a deeper look at the contents of the ARP Request and ARP Response packets between Host A and Host B. This is what allows the target (Host B, in this case) to respond directly back to the initiator (Host A). Notice the ARP Request includes the sender’s MAC address. The entire process is illustrated in this animation: Since the target knows who sent the initial ARP Request, it is able to send the ARP Response unicast, directly back to the initiator. The node which is the target of the ARP Request will then send an ARP Response back to the original sender. The nodes which are not the intended target will silently discard the packet. All nodes will take a look at the content of the ARP request to determine whether they are the intended target.
![use arp command to find mac address use arp command to find mac address](http://lh3.ggpht.com/-UmSzkpcgABo/Uj2dynxDJLI/AAAAAAAAA9s/1nLBB-9RHl8/image_thumb%25255B5%25255D.png)
Since it was a broadcast, all nodes on the network will receive the ARP Request. This request must be a broadcast, because at this point the initiator does not know the target’s MAC address, and is therefore unable to send a unicast frame to the target. It starts with the initiator sending an ARP Request as a broadcast frame to the entire network. The Address Resolution itself is a two step process – a request and a response. If a Router is delivering a packet to the next Router in the path to the host, the ARP target will be the other Router’s Interface IP address – as indicated by the relative entry in the Routing table. In the same way, if a Router is delivering a packet to the destination host, the Router’s ARP target will be the Host’s IP address. If a host is speaking to another host on a different IP network, the target for the ARP request will be the Default Gateway’s IP address. If a host is speaking to another host on the same IP network, the target for the ARP request is the other host’s IP address. The “next NIC” in the path will become the target of the ARP request. The purpose for creating such a mapping is so a packet’s L2 header can be properly populated to deliver a packet to the next NIC in the path between two end points. Use the navigation boxes to view the rest of the articles.Īs we’ve learned before, the Address Resolution Protocol (ARP) is the process by which a known 元 address is mapped to an unknown L2 address. the following error is returned.This article is a part of a series on Address Resolution Protocol (ARP). If the remote host operating system is Non-Windows like Linux, MacOSX, Android, iOS, etc. The /s option and the remote computer IP address are provided to the getmac command. This command do not works with the other operating systems like Linux.
USE ARP COMMAND TO FIND MAC ADDRESS WINDOWS 10
Keep in mind that the remote computer should be a Windows operating system like Windows XP, Windows 7, Windows 8, Windows 10 or Windows Server. This protocol can be used with the getmac command in order to get remote computer MAC address. Windows operating systems provide the NetBIOS protocol as an management and information sharing protocol. arp -a Find MAC Address via Windows GetMAC Command Now we list the ARP table with the arp command by providing the -a option to list all entries in the ARP table. This ping command triggers the ARP protocol and the IP address and MAC address resolution is stored in the ARP table. First we should communicate with the destination hosts IP address by simply ping to it. The ARP is a protocol used to resolve IP addresses into MAC addresses and named after “Address Resolution Protocol”. network stack stores the IP address and MAC address relations in a table named ARP Table. In a operating system like Windows, Linux, MacOSX etc. Find MAC Address via ARP Protocol and Table
USE ARP COMMAND TO FIND MAC ADDRESS HOW TO
In this tutorial, we examine how to find the MAC address of a host or network interface card by using its IP address. Even IP address is the global way to find a host in the last step of transmission the MAC address is used to identify hosts by translating the IP address into the MAC address. The MAC address is used to identify different network interfaces in a local area network or LAN. The IP address is used to address different hosts in a network with different identities.